Output 7fbeadc2660fc4b65f54b9266c89146233ef5523e39303fdd4b131ce63005853:1

value
1616843
script pubkey
OP_0 OP_PUSHBYTES_20 51384fe7250ad586e79e4ac803bd00ad68342a8a
address
bc1q2yuylee9pt2cdeu7ftyq80gq445rg252lwjxzq
transaction
7fbeadc2660fc4b65f54b9266c89146233ef5523e39303fdd4b131ce63005853
spent
true